Dionne Warwick promo clip filmed in Paris. Music by Burt Bacharach and Hal David.
"The song peaked at number 6 on the US Billboard Hot 100 and number 1 on the Cash Box Rhythm and Blues Chart In June 1964 and was nominated for a 1965 Grammy Award for the Best Rhythm and Blues Recording." -Wikipedia
